Output e64305ebd723a3e9ba6d7b90f31d032328b760d84bbd0d71ac36e4a06d333a11:0

value
1740053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f11f43069b91cc48c7ec7331a7e1f0fd79164aa OP_EQUAL
address
37SW15uWVV94pDvZNiDdkAGWnFHz3jM828
transaction
e64305ebd723a3e9ba6d7b90f31d032328b760d84bbd0d71ac36e4a06d333a11
spent
true